What even is vegan fashion?

Whether you’re looking into veganism for the first time or need some new cruelty-free clothes, supporting vegan fashion brands can be a great option for sourcing versatile and affordable threads.

While there is no overarching legal definition of these terms, “veganism” is typically defined as abstaining from the use of animal products, particularly in diet, and an associated philosophy that rejects the commodity status of animals.

When it comes to fashion, vegan clothing means any garment made without animal-derived materials. Some products like leather obviously come from animals, but others are a little harder to spot, such as fur, mohair, wool, cashmere, angora, feathers, silk, or animal-derived dyes and glues.
